Am I legally required to notify my neighbor before building a fence on the property line?
Yes. Louisiana Civil Code Article 684, the state's 'good neighbor law,' governs partition fences. For a shared boundary, you must provide formal written notice to the adjoining owner before construction or replacement. This is a strict 2026 legal requirement in Haughton to establish shared cost liability and prevent disputes. We recommend sending notice via certified mail and retaining proof of delivery.
How do I choose fence materials for Haughton's soil and pest conditions?
Material compatibility is non-negotiable. The soil has a moderate corrosivity index, mandating hot-dip galvanized steel posts and stainless-ste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ks. Given the very heavy termite risk, pressure-treated pine must be rated for ground contact (UC4A), or use composite or metal alternatives. We specify aluminum or vinyl for full perimeter screens in termite-prone areas of Haughton Proper.
Why is a proper footing critical for a fence in Haughton?
The frost line depth is 0 inches in Haughton, but wind stability is the primary engineering challenge. Posts must be set in concrete piers sized for the 105 MPH V-ult wind load. An undersized footing will allow the post to pivot in the soil during high-wind events common to the I-20 corridor, leading to a cascading structural failure. We design footings to IRC and ASCE 7-22 standards to resist overturning forces.
What are the height and placement rules for a fence in Haughton Proper?
Zoning limits are 4 feet in the front yard and 8 feet in the rear yard, with a 0-foot setback allowing construction directly on the property line. The critical rule for corner lots involves the 'sight triangle'—a zone at intersections where fences over 3 feet tall are prohibited. This is strictly enforced near high-traffic areas like I-20 feeder roads to maintain driver visibility. We survey the lot to map these exclusion zones before design.

What is required before you can dig the first post hole?
The first step is a mandatory utility locate request via Louisiana 811. Hitting a gas, fiber, or power line in Haughton Proper is a major liability that incurs repair costs and fines. We manage the 811 ticket and the Haughton permit office paperwork concurrently. The permit requires a site plan showing the fence location relative to property lines and structures, which we draft and submit as part of our service.
Do modern pool fence and gate codes allow for smart technology?
Yes. Modern systems integrate IoT latches and smart gate operators that comply with IRC Appendix AG and IBC pool barrier codes. The code requires self-closing, self-latching gates with a release mechanism at least 54 inches high. Smart systems can provide audit logs and remote status alerts, which meet updated liability standards for Louisiana homeowners by demonstrating proactive safety management.
